According to Fox News, the U.S. Embassy in Havana reported that Cuba is currently experiencing a total power failure caused by an electrical grid collapse. The embassy statement, obtained by Fox News, advised all U.S. citizens in Cuba or planning travel there to "be aware and plan accordingly."
This matters because total grid failures—even in single nations—expose critical vulnerabilities in power infrastructure recovery, communications, emergency response, and supply chain resilience. Cuba's electrical system has faced documented stress in recent years, and a nationwide collapse of this scope indicates either cascading infrastructure failure, fuel supply disruption, or generation capacity loss severe enough to take the entire grid offline simultaneously.
For preparedness analysts, this event underscores why grid-dependent systems (water treatment, fuel pumping, hospital backup power, communications towers) fail in sequence once primary power is lost.
